From 38151187bf66583734637a32be436df226133ce9 Mon Sep 17 00:00:00 2001 From: Robert Shih Date: Tue, 5 Apr 2022 18:49:06 +0000 Subject: [PATCH] Pixel 2022: MediaDrm AIDL sepolicy Bug: 219538389 Bug: 221180205 Change-Id: I985230093d692fcf948049455fa465fce116d2a6 Test: atest VtsAidlHalDrmTargetTest --- widevine/file_contexts | 6 +++--- widevine/service_contexts | 1 + 2 files changed, 4 insertions(+), 3 deletions(-) create mode 100644 widevine/service_contexts diff --git a/widevine/file_contexts b/widevine/file_contexts index e1529417..92aed3c3 100644 --- a/widevine/file_contexts +++ b/widevine/file_contexts @@ -1,5 +1,5 @@ -/vendor/bin/hw/android\.hardware\.drm@1\.4-service\.widevine u:object_r:hal_drm_widevine_exec:s0 -/vendor/bin/hw/android\.hardware\.drm@[0-9]+\.[0-9]+-service\.clearkey u:object_r:hal_drm_clearkey_exec:s0 +/vendor/bin/hw/android\.hardware\.drm-service\.widevine u:object_r:hal_drm_widevine_exec:s0 +/vendor/bin/hw/android\.hardware\.drm-service\.clearkey u:object_r:hal_drm_clearkey_exec:s0 # Data -/data/vendor/mediadrm(/.*)? u:object_r:mediadrm_vendor_data_file:s0 +/data/vendor/mediadrm(/.*)? u:object_r:mediadrm_vendor_data_file:s0 diff --git a/widevine/service_contexts b/widevine/service_contexts new file mode 100644 index 00000000..6989dde8 --- /dev/null +++ b/widevine/service_contexts @@ -0,0 +1 @@ +android.hardware.drm.IDrmFactory/widevine u:object_r:hal_drm_service:s0